Description

Do note that this is not a regular course, this is more of a workshop. Here's how it works: The instructor, Mr. P R Sundar, will be available live on a ZOOM video call, where he'll be giving a short introduction. There are 10 chapters in total. 5 chapters for Saturday, and 5 chapters for Sunday. After finishing each chapter, you need to come back to the ZOOM Videocall for a Q&A session, any doubts you have regarding the chapter you just watched, feel free to ask. The Q&A session will go on for 30-45 minutes, where Mr. P R Sundar will be giving additional tips and guidance.

this review is for those are on the fence (still deciding) about registering for the workshop: I spent nearly 2 months to decide whether i should pay the hefty sum of 50k for the 2 day workshop. I was making some and losing some money in the markets. I would come frequently to the workshop page to read reviews and continue to think if i should attend. I finally managed to pay the fees and it was worth it. for me, workshop is paisa vasool. this workshop is most useful to people who already have knowledge and some experience in trading Options. some tips for people ready to attend the workshop: do your homework before you attend. Read the basic concepts. be prepared with all the arrangements - internet, mobile/laptop charging etc. keep the session days distraction free so that you can focus on workshop. keep notepad and pen handy - i would take notes. ask quetions in the QnA section.
